Output f656d37f4e6771b2d908977581fbac6f52d3376519ff38981e8e2c0f3b3c219e:1

value
2518189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 beae96fbd4f80720e4e7a545032752405af78a0e OP_EQUAL
address
3K5FThgCUa781Wtqtbmai58Q3JnfickYYP
transaction
f656d37f4e6771b2d908977581fbac6f52d3376519ff38981e8e2c0f3b3c219e
spent
true